sUthram 13
அணுவானபடியென்னென்னில்
(aNuvAnapadi en ennil)
Meaning: If the self is distinct from matter, self-luminous, blissful, and eternal, how do we know that it is atomic in size?
Explanation
So far, the self has been described as:
- distinct from matter (achith),
- self-luminous (ajada),
- of the nature of bliss (Anandha rUpam),
- and eternal (nithya).
Even after accepting all these qualities, one may still wonder whether the self is all-pervading (vibhu) or atomic (aNu).
A seeker may therefore raise the following question:
“If the self possesses all these qualities, on what basis do we conclude that it is atomic in size?”
The commentator introduces that doubt here and prepares for its resolution in the following sUthrams.
No answer is given yet. The present sUthram merely raises the enquiry regarding the atomic nature of the self.
